  • The University of Georgia announced that it will demolish Legion Pool, its pool house and concert stand while redeveloping Legion Field into a larger greenspace with an outdoor amphitheater and 70 new parking spaces. The project will finish in Fall 2026—reallocating student fees to better support campus needs.  Flagpole

  • University of Georgia students in Athens form the Spike Squad, a fan group known for wearing shoulder pads and face paint at football games while also supporting charity work. The group began around 2010 and selects members through social events—members show their team spirit by arriving early and following long-standing traditions.  Athens Banner-Herald
